Improve warning suppression for inlined functions. gcc/ChangeLog: * config/aarch64/aarch64-builtins.c (aarch64_simd_expand_builtin): Remove %K and use error_at. (aarch64_expand_fcmla_builtin): Same. (aarch64_expand_builtin_tme): Same. (aarch64_expand_builtin_memtag): Same. * config/arm/arm-builtins.c (arm_expand_acle_builtin): Same.
